C4WS Homeless Project
(C4WS. Formerly known as Community of Camden Churches Cold Weather Shelter)
Annual winter shelter/emergency accommodation in various venues. Clients accept the shelter's ethos and terms of residence. No alcohol allowed on the premises. Mentoring and befriending scheme, English classes, weekly lunch time drop-in.
